Commanders Sign TE Chig Okonkwo and S Nick Cross

The Commanders have made significant roster moves by signing tight end Chig Okonkwo and safety Nick Cross. These additions are expected to enhance the team’s overall performance.

Chig Okonkwo’s Contract Details

Chig Okonkwo, 26, has agreed to a three-year contract with the Commanders. Although specific financial terms have not been disclosed, he ranks 93rd on Pro Football Talk’s top-100 free agents list.

Okonkwo’s Background

  • Drafted by the Tennessee Titans as a fourth-round pick in 2022.
  • Competed in 68 games, with 42 starts, during his four seasons with Tennessee.
  • Career stats: 194 receptions, 2,017 yards, 8 touchdowns.

Nick Cross’s Contract and Achievements

Safety Nick Cross, 24, signed a two-year deal with the potential to earn up to $14 million. His experience and skills will be vital for the Commanders’ defense.

Cross’s Career Overview

  • Selected by the Indianapolis Colts as a third-round draft choice in 2022.
  • Played in 67 games, starting in 38 over four seasons with the Colts.
  • Defensive stats: 322 tackles, 3.5 sacks, 5 interceptions, 12 pass breakups, 2 forced fumbles.
